1. Minimalist Micro Heart Nails

Minimalist micro heart nails are the ultimate choice for those who love subtle beauty with emotional impact. This design focuses on tiny heart details placed delicately across neutral or soft-toned bases. Rather than dominating the nail, these hearts act as charming accents that feel modern, clean, and effortlessly chic.

This style typically features nude, blush, milky white, sheer pink, or soft beige backgrounds with a single micro heart on each nail or a heart placed on only one or two accent nails. The hearts may be drawn using fine line brushes or dotting tools, creating small, crisp shapes that appear almost like jewelry for the nails.

Micro heart nails work beautifully on short nails, making them ideal for professionals, students, or anyone who prefers low-maintenance manicures that still feel stylish. They pair well with almond, squoval, and rounded nail shapes, reinforcing the soft and understated aesthetic.

Color combinations remain gentle and balanced. Popular pairings include white hearts on blush bases, black hearts on sheer nude backgrounds, and red hearts on milky pink polish. Gold foil hearts also add a luxurious minimal touch without overwhelming the look.

This design is perfect for everyday wear, engagement celebrations, bridal showers, or subtle romantic gestures. It communicates affection without feeling overly decorative, making it ideal for both minimalist fashion lovers and those new to nail art.

To elevate micro heart nails, consider using glossy top coats for clean shine or matte finishes for a modern editorial feel. You can also experiment with asymmetrical placement, such as placing hearts near the cuticle, at the side edge, or floating slightly off-center for artistic interest.


2. French Tip Hearts Manicure

French tip heart nails are a romantic reinterpretation of the classic French manicure. Instead of traditional straight white tips, this design replaces the tip line with heart shapes or curved heart halves, creating a soft and flirty look that feels both timeless and trendy.

The most popular version involves forming a heart shape at the tip of the nail using two curved strokes that meet in the center. This gives the illusion that the heart sits gently on the nail’s edge, framing the tip area with a sweet silhouette. This style works especially well on almond, oval, and coffin-shaped nails, where the curved tip provides space for heart shaping.

Color combinations can range from classic red on nude bases to soft pastel hearts on milky pink polish. For a more modern take, black heart tips on sheer bases offer bold contrast, while metallic hearts add a glamorous twist.

French heart tips are incredibly versatile. They suit bridal nails, date nights, Valentine’s-inspired sets, and even everyday wear when done in neutral shades. They can be paired with glossy finishes for elegance or matte bases for a contemporary feel.

For those seeking added complexity, accent nails can feature full hearts, mini rhinestones, or subtle glitter fades. Some variations also include reverse French hearts, where the heart shape appears at the cuticle instead of the tip, creating a fresh visual effect.

This design bridges classic and modern aesthetics beautifully, making it a top choice for Pinterest users who want nails that feel romantic yet polished.

9. 3D Heart Embellishment Nails

3D heart nails transform traditional heart designs into bold, sculptural statements. This style incorporates raised heart charms, acrylic sculpted hearts, rhinestone clusters, pearl hearts, or gel-built shapes that extend beyond the nail surface, creating dimensional texture and visual drama.

This design works best on medium to long nails, especially coffin, stiletto, and almond shapes where there is enough surface area to balance embellishments without overcrowding. Base colors are often neutral, glossy, or softly tinted to allow the 3D hearts to stand out as focal points.

Popular variations include chrome hearts on nude bases, pearl hearts on milky white nails, crystal hearts on blush polish, or sculpted gel hearts in monochrome color schemes. Some designs incorporate layered textures such as glitter, foil, and rhinestones surrounding the heart embellishment for added depth.

3D heart nails are ideal for special occasions such as weddings, proposals, photoshoots, birthdays, anniversaries, and formal events where dramatic beauty is welcome. They photograph exceptionally well and create jewelry-like effects on the hands.

Because of their raised surface, these designs require careful application and sealing to ensure durability and comfort. A strong top coat and proper structure prevent snagging and enhance wear time.

This manicure style is for individuals who love statement beauty and expressive artistry. It pushes heart nail designs into couture territory, turning nails into wearable sculptures that celebrate romance, luxury, and bold creativity.
